Jaime P. Serrat

Picture
Attorney Jaime P. Serrat
Mr. Serrat began his career at the Cuyahoga County Public Defender’s Office where he worked for five years.  Since then, he has been successful in his own private practice for the last 35 years. During Mr. Serrat’s practice of law, he has been admitted to practice in:
  •          The State of Ohio
  •          United States District Court for the Northern District of Ohio
  •          United States District Court for the Western District of New York
  •          Sixth Circuit Court of Appeals
  •          Third Circuit Court of Appeals
  •          United States Supreme Court
  •          The State of North Carolina (currently inactive)
  •          Pro Hac Vice in numerous jurisdictions

Jaime Serrat has been attorney of record in over 500 Federal Court Cases in the Northern District of Ohio.

Personal History

Attorney Jaime P. Serrat was born and raised in Tarragona, Spain.  He moved to the United States with his brothers and sisters when he was fifteen years old.  After completing high school in the Cleveland area, he attended Mount Union College and received a BA in Political Science on June 11, 1978.  At Mount Union College, Mr. Serrat was a member of the Phi Gamma Mu National Honor Society and a member of the varsity men's soccer team.

Attorney Serrat obtained his Juris Doctorate from Cleveland-Marshall College of Law on December 17, 1982.  Mr. Serrat was admitted to practice in the Federal Court for the Northern District of Ohio on April 21, 1986.  He was also admitted to practice in the Supreme Court of Ohio on May 9, 1983 and the United States Court of Appeals for the Sixth Circuit on July 18, 1994.

On January 29, 1982, Mr. Serrat was honored with the Cuyahoga County Public Defender Meritorious Service Award, which he also received on October 18, 1985.  Mr. Serrat was awarded the Legal Aid Society of Cleveland Certificate of Appreciation on October 25, 2000.  In recognition of his outstanding volunteer services with the 3Rs - Rights Responsibilities - Realities, the Cleveland Metropolitan Bar Association presented Mr. Serrat with a Certificate of Achievement and Appreciation for the 2010-2011 3Rs year. The 3Rs program is where members of the Cleveland legal community partner with local schools to personally connect with high school students to address fundamental real-world issues the students face, focusing on the U.S. Constitution to help the students:
  • Improve understanding of and respect for the rule of law and our Constitution;
  • Improve passage of the Ohio Graduation Test;
  • Provide practical career counseling to focus students on their potential beyond high school; and
  • Improve the “pipeline” of minorities flowing into legal careers in the region.
